Transaction 13b21eb592598a35491542c7d90724b76205024e545cbbb4e796014b164bdd34
1 Input
1 Output
-
13b21eb592598a35491542c7d90724b76205024e545cbbb4e796014b164bdd34: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 00996bcf195c5b56293b44cd0c0cfac8e9d35dfa8b8ea7b31eb74c19d3fc970b
- address
- bc1pqzvkhncet3d4v2fmgnxscr86er5axh063w820vc7kaxpn5luju9s8fgx9k